Provost addresses tenure clock extensions, grading options

In a memo, Jonathan Wickert said all tenure-track faculty who request a one-year extension due to COVID-19 impacts will receive it. Undergraduates who had their classes moved online have the option of taking the course pass/not pass.

Search, hiring changes are in effect until May

Searches to fill noncritical job vacancies should be postponed until the end of spring semester, and critical-need vacancies will require approval at the senior vice president level before they can be posted.
